Root Zone Requirements
Different bonsai species have distinct root zone requirements, with some preferring shallow containers to accommodate their naturally compact root systems, while others thrive in deeper pots that allow for extensive root growth.
For bonsai for beginners, understanding these requirements is vital, as it directly impacts the tree's overall health and stability.
For instance, species like Juniper and Pine, which have naturally shallow root systems, do well in shallower containers, whereas species like Elm and Beech, with deeper root systems, require more depth.
When selecting a pot, consider the species' natural growth patterns and adapt accordingly. A general rule of thumb is to provide at least 1-2 inches of depth for every inch of trunk diameter. However, this can vary depending on the species and desired aesthetic.

Juniper Root Needs
Juniper species, renowned for their rugged, adaptable nature, exhibit distinct root requirements that necessitate a tailored approach to repotting depth.
These evergreen conifers thrive in well-draining soil, necessitating a shallower repotting depth to prevent waterlogged conditions that can lead to root rot.
A general guideline for juniper species is to repot them at a depth that allows the first true roots to be just above the soil surface, typically around 1-2 inches.
This shallow repotting depth enables the roots to breathe, promoting healthy growth and preventing moisture buildup.
Additionally, junipers benefit from a slightly raised root system, which can be achieved by creating a gentle mound in the pot.
This elevation helps to improve drainage and aeration, further supporting the juniper's root needs.

Common Mistakes to Avoid
When repotting bonsai, it's crucial to avoid common mistakes that can hinder the tree's growth and stability.
- Insufficient root pruning: Failing to prune roots during repotting can lead to root bound conditions, reducing the tree's ability to absorb water and nutrients.
- Inadequate drainage: Using a potting mix that lacks proper drainage can cause waterlogged soil, leading to root rot and other problems.
- Incorrect pot size: Using a pot that is too small or too large can disrupt the tree's balance and stability, making it more prone to disease and pests.

Will a Deeper Pot Always Lead to a Healthier Bonsai Tree?
While a deeper pot can provide more room for root growth, it's not a guarantee of a healthier bonsai tree. In fact, excessive depth can lead to waterlogging, root rot, and reduced oxygen availability, ultimately hindering the tree's overall health.
